## Runbook: TumbleVault locker access flow

When a resident can't open their laundry locker, it's almost always the token handshake timing out, not the hardware. Don't dispatch a tech until you've checked the Spindrift relay logs. If the relay looks healthy, restart the access service on the hub — it's quick. Before release sign-off, confirm the service comes up with these values.

deployment values, yadup-kadug:
[sorys]
port = 5672
team = noveth
host = sorys.orvexcorp.example
region = south-4
access_code = ac_deddc1
timeout_ms = 1500

Subject: Night access to the recording studio (Room 4.12)

Hi night shift team,

A reminder that the training-video studio on the fourth floor is now available overnight for the Quillford onboarding series. Please keep the soundproof door fully closed while recording, switch off the ring lights when finished, and log your session times in the wall folder. The studio door is on a separate lock from the corridor, so you'll need the code below.

Best,
Front Desk

door code, yagap-bahof: bdg-O-05

Approved offers already extended will be honored; all other requisitions are suspended. Branches should plan staffing around current headcount, using cross-training and temporary reassignment from the Fieldworks pool where needed. Overtime budgets remain unchanged. Performance targets for the division will be reviewed at the mid-quarter checkpoint with Orla Venn's team. The reasoning behind this decision is summarized in the confidential note below.

confidential, yahip-hagug: Gorixax Logistics plans to lower the Ulaael list price by 26.6 percent in October. The pricing group signed off on a budget of $199.9 million for Project Holix. The renewal with Kasdorox Systems closes at $137.5 million a year, 8.2 percent above the last contract. Project Lamion slips by a full year because of the audit delay.